P201 Predictors of early colectomy in ulcerative colitis: a real-world cohort study

Introduction Despite advances in medical therapy, a substantial proportion of patients with ulcerative colitis (UC) still require surgery, often early in the disease course. Identifying predictors of early colectomy may help optimise treatment strategies and improve patient outcomes.Methods We conducted a retrospective monocentric observational study including 95 UC patients who underwent surgery, selected from a cohort of 601 patients followed between 2005 and 2025 in a tertiary referral centre. Early surgery was defined as colectomy performed within 12 months of UC diagnosis. Patients operated on for non-UC indications or with incomplete data were excluded. Clinical, endoscopic and biological variables were analysed. Factors associated with early colectomy were assessed using univariate analysis followed by multivariable logistic regression.Results Mean age at diagnosis was 33.6 years (median 32), with a balanced sex ratio (52% male). Extensive disease (E3) was present in 66% of patients, and severe endoscopic activity (Mayo endoscopic score = 3) in 66%. Preoperative corticosteroids were used in 74% of patients, immunomodulators in 36% and anti-TNF therapy in 7%.In multivariable analysis, older age at diagnosis (OR 1.04 per year, 95% CI 1.00–1.09; p = 0.04), severe endoscopic activity (Mayo 3) (OR 1.30, 95% CI 1.02–1.68; p = 0.03), and hypoalbuminaemia <30 g/L (OR 0.85, 95% CI 0.74–0.98; p = 0.02) were independently associated with early colectomy. C-reactive protein levels, haemoglobin, smoking status and corticosteroid exposure were not independently associated with early surgery.Conclusions Early colectomy in UC is primarily driven by disease severity at diagnosis, particularly severe endoscopic inflammation and hypoalbuminaemia. These readily available parameters may help identify patients at high risk of early surgery who could benefit from early treatment optimisation and closer monitoring.
